A big surprise the model awaits at the 2024 Zurich Classic: McIlroy and Lowry, who have combined for 26 PGA Tour victories, barely managed to get into the top five. McIlroy is set to play in his fourth consecutive event when he starts at TPC Louisiana. He has failed to crack the top 10 in seven of his eight PGA Tour starts this season, while Lowry has finished T-19 or worse in six of his last eight events.

Both players have struggled on the pitch this season. McIlroy enters the 2024 Zurich Classic ranked 78th in strokes gained: putting (.119) and 72nd in putting average (1.758), a big reason why he ranks 98th in scoring average (70.44). Lowry, meanwhile, ranks 99th in strokes gained: putting (-0.012) and 143rd in strokes per round (29.38), which doesn’t bode well for his chances of finishing at the top of the leaderboard this week.

Another surprise: Rasmus Højgaard and Nicolai Højgaard, with 35-1 from distance, are having a good campaign for the title. The twin brothers have a much better chance of winning it all than their odds suggest, so they’re a target for anyone looking for a big payout.

The Danish duo have been making headlines overseas for years, becoming the first brothers to win events in consecutive weeks on the European Tour in 2021. They are now making noise on the PGA Tour, as Nicolai finished second at the Farmers Insurance Open back in January and finished T16 in his first Masters appearance earlier this month.
